DESCRIPTION:Special Guest: Aya De Leon\n\nFilmmaker and Executive Director of World 
 Trust Educational Services, Inc., Dr. Shakti Butler will be premiering her 
 latest documentary, Mirrors of Privilege: Making Whiteness Visible - a 
 must-see for all people who are interested in justice, spiritual growth and 
 community making.  It features the experiences of white women and men who 
 have worked to gain insight into what it means to challenge notions of 
 racism and white supremacy in the United States.  \n\nThe participants’ 
 up-close and personal reflections provide access into their journeys of 
 learning and transformation. Their conversations reveal what is often 
 required to expose the denial, defensiveness, guilt, fear and shame that 
 helps keep systemic racism in place.  The result of this type of work 
 demonstrates the skills and capacities needed to make solid commitments 
 towards building racial justice. Dr. Butler’s work moves conversations 
 beyond black and white and speaks to the interconnectedness of racism, 
 classism, sexism, and homophobia.\n\nTickets are available by emailing
